Development description

Permission for development which will consist of change of crèche plans, elevations and revised roof type from the crèche plans previously granted under planning applications reference numbers: 19/366, 19/68.19/208 and 17/30 and all ancillary site works

Land-use zoning

What this land is zoned for

ResidentialRS
To provide residential development and for associated support development, which will ensure the protection of existing residential amenity and will contribute to sustainable residential neighbourhoods

National zoning type: Residential, mixed residential and other uses
